YELLOW LATERAL NAIL FOLD

A yellow lateral nail fold can have many causes. Usually the yellow colour is seen with a 'swelling' - often caused by for example nail biting or nail picking. Sometimes the yellow is caused by another nail problem, like for example: paronychia, ingrown nails [source: AAFP]

TREATMENT: 1) warm water soaks, 2) drainage of abscess

Synonyms: paronychia, nail fold edema/oedema

THE NAIL UNIT

The eight basic components of the nail unit include: 1 - proximal nail fold; 2 - cuticle; 3 - lunula; 4 - nail plate; 5 - lateral nail folds; 6 - nail bed; 7 - hyponychium; 8 - free edge.
